What is a SIP
panel extension?
A SIP (Structural Insulated Panel) extension uses factory-manufactured panels that combine structural strength and high-performance insulation in a single component. Each panel consists of a rigid insulation core bonded between two structural facing boards — creating a wall or roof element that is simultaneously load-bearing and thermally efficient.
Because the structure and insulation are integrated, SIP extensions eliminate the thermal bridging found in traditional construction — resulting in a warmer, more energy-efficient space that performs consistently throughout the year.

How a SIP panel
is constructed.
Each SIP panel is a composite component — three distinct layers that work together to deliver structural performance and thermal efficiency in a single, factory-manufactured unit.
Structural facing board
The outer layer is a structural board — typically oriented strand board (OSB) — that provides the rigidity and load-bearing capacity of the panel. It forms the structural skin of the extension wall or roof element.
High-performance insulation core
The insulation core — expanded polystyrene (EPS) or polyurethane foam — is bonded directly to both facing boards under pressure. This continuous core eliminates the air gaps and thermal bridges that occur in traditional stud-and-insulation construction, dramatically improving thermal performance.
Internal structural board
The inner facing board mirrors the outer layer — providing the structural integrity of the panel from the inside, a continuous surface for internal finishes, and a substrate for service routes routed within the panel.

Why choose a SIP
panel extension?
SIP extensions combine structural performance, thermal efficiency and fast installation in a single system — with full architect design and no compromise on layout or appearance.
Superior thermal performance
The continuous insulation core of a SIP panel eliminates thermal bridging — delivering a warmer, more consistent internal environment and lower heating costs compared to traditional stud-and-insulation construction.
Factory precision
Panels are manufactured off-site to exact tolerances in controlled conditions, not cut and fitted on site. The result is consistent quality that doesn't vary with weather, workmanship or site conditions.
Fast installation
SIP panels arrive on site ready to assemble, significantly reducing the on-site construction programme compared to traditional build — meaning less disruption to your household and a faster route to enjoying your new space.
